Rating: 5
Summary: A book that every Muslim should read in North America
Comment: Many Muslims will not read this book because they will feel that it is too honest. They will say, "Why show the negative about Islam and Muslims when non-Muslims do enough of that anyway?" some will say. Or others will say, "if you are Muslim, you should write about how wonderful it is to be Muslim, how we treat women wonderfully and why one should convert to Islam." Many will argue that this book does not do that. However, I will say that it does. In an honest and refreshing manner, this book captures the problems that face Muslims today. Many Muslims will admit that although they believe that Islam is the true religion and Allah is the true God, sometimes the practice of Islam by Muslims today is not as beautiful as Islam itself. Many times, Muslims practice Islam in a "cultural" way rather than an "Islamic" way. Things that are only talked about in inner circles in a hush-hush manner (and some things that are not talked about at all, such as sexual abuse) are addressed openly in this book for the first time in Muslim American history. How wonderful it is to read a book on Islam that states, "these things happen, but Islam is STILL beautiful." And when you read this book, you understand why that is true. I learned a lot from this book about Muslims, Islam and what beauty is in Islam. "The Sunnah of the Beloved" captures the Muslim's soul when thinking of the beloved Prophet Muhammad in such a way that every Muslim will be reduced to tears. If you want to change your life and the way you view the world, read this book. If you are afraid of changing your worldview and knowing what's going on in the world then at least have someone else read it for you and tell you which parts to read (such as Sunnah of the Beloved, that must be read by every Muslim.)
